Typical Issues with Window Frames

  1. Splitting and Splitting
    • This is frequently triggered by direct exposure to severe weather, such as direct sunlight and extreme winter seasons.
  2. Rotting
    • Wood frames are particularly prone to rot due to moisture accumulation.
  3. Drafts
    • Gaps in the frame can lead to air leakages, minimizing energy effectiveness.
  4. Deformed Frames
    • Contorting can happen due to humidity modifications and incorrect installation.
  5. Fading and Discoloration
    • UV rays can cause paint and wood to fade in time.
